Question-
how often do you test CYA and does it change quite often or does that depend on things like rain and such?
I posted my results earlier and my CYA was the 30-50 range with the walmart test strip.
thanks
Once CYA is in the water, it is only lost from splash out or drainage, like when you backwash, etc.
No need to continually test it unless you experience one of those situations or you use a chlorine product that adds it, like di or tri-chlor.
Once I get my cya reading where I want it, I probably only test it once or twice more for the whole season.
